Renaissance polyphony without sheet music? Based on ancient sources, the ensemble Le Bois Chantant sings the music of the 16th and 17th centuries as close as possible to the improvised reality that must have existed in a world without electric light and abundant sheet music: counterpoint by ear and spontaneously, originals are playfully expanded and altered, past and present meet in a musical reload.
